Have you settled? Have you allowed him to get away with limited meeting of your needs to the point that he's "comfortable" doing so? I believe that men, more than women can get comfortable in a relationship early on and if the woman allows, excepts or settles for the level of behavior at that time, then that's all their going to get.
I think you need to have a "knee to knee" conversation with him about all topics that have to do with intimacy (Romance, being romanced, kissing, holding hands, BJs, HJs, making love, having sex, anal sex, etc.) All of the things that you are doing currently, what you like and don't like and the things you feel are lacking or things that you need. You have to tell your man what you expect/need in order to have any chance of receiving it. It usually takes more than once too.
"Every girl wants to be seduced and made to feel like the sexiest, most desirable thing on the planet" EXACTLY! It would appear to me that you have settled and allowed him to "get away with" certain things, while you continue to perform for him at the level he expects....frequent BJs.
A one on one, knee to knee conversation should help reverse/improve the areas you have mentioned.
Remember ladies, we men aren't mind readers....We need you to put the dots very close together for us to see a line. Until we learn, we need a fairly tight collar and short leash (so to speak).
I hope this helps.
P.S. For those of you that don't know, there is something unique about having a conversation with somebody else when you're facing each other and so close that your
knees are touching. It forces you to be in touch with the person you are talking with and seems to increase the level of clear communication due in part to the
close proximity. For a more personal/intimate approach....rest your forearms on your thighs or hold hands while you're talking with one another.Comment
